Weather here isn't as harsh as some places, but the temperature swings between wet winter mornings and dry summer afternoons take a toll on springs and cables. Most torsion springs last 7 to 9 years here, not the 10 some manufacturers claim. The moisture doesn't help. We see rust on bottom panels and weatherstripping that needs replacement more often than in drier climates. Openers can act up too when the humidity changes suddenly.
Common problems we fix in Gresham include broken springs (by far the most frequent call), garage doors that reverse for no clear reason, noisy rollers that wake up the whole house, and openers that work intermittently. Cable breaks are less common but more dangerous. If you see a cable hanging loose, don't operate the door.
Our most common service call is torsion spring replacement. When a spring breaks, the door becomes too heavy to lift safely. We carry commercial-grade springs on every truck and can typically complete spring replacement in under an hour. We replace both springs even if only one broke, because the second one is under the same stress and will fail soon anyway.

Cable and roller repair keeps doors running smoothly. If your door sounds like a freight train, worn rollers are usually the culprit. We replace them with nylon-coated models that last longer and run quieter. Frayed cables need immediate attention because a snapped cable can cause the door to fall on one side.

What's included in your maintenance service?
Annual maintenance includes a 20-point safety inspection, lubrication of all moving parts, balance testing, photo-eye alignment, and weatherstripping check. We adjust spring tension if needed and tighten all hardware. This typically takes 30 to 45 minutes and can prevent expensive repairs by catching small issues early.
